ACER Academic Scholarship
The ACER Academic Scholarships are available to students entering Years 3 or 4 in 2027.
Successful candidates may receive a remission of up to half of the base tuition fees each year, continuing until the conclusion of Year 6 at St Andrew’s School.
The objective of the Academic Scholarship is to acknowledge and enhance students’ academic abilities, ultimately supporting them in reaching their full academic potential.
As part of the application process, students will be required to take part in a standardised test that is externally moderated. The ACER Scholarship Tests are used nationwide to identify academically capable students.
Applicants are required to demonstrate a range of skills such as the ability to interpret, infer, deduce and think critically. The tests are not curriculum-based and do not test the ability to retrieve learned knowledge, nor are they diagnostic.

Music Scholarship
Music Scholarships are open to students in Years 3 and 4 in 2027.
Successful applicants may receive a remission of up to half of the base tuition fees each year, continuing until the conclusion of Year 6 at St Andrew’s School.
The aim of the Music Scholarship is to recognise and extend the musical ability of the successful applicant. Students will be required to demonstrate an excellent attitude towards their music studies and set a high standard of performance both as a soloist and in ensembles.
As part of the application process, students will be required to complete an aural exam demonstrating a high music ability to play on two instruments. Two contrasting pieces of music for the main instrument and one piece for each additional instrument, including voice, is required for the exam.

Nurturing Greatness Scholarship
The Nurturing Greatness Scholarship is open to prospective students entering Reception to Year 6 in 2027. This scholarship will be awarded to students who exemplify our School values, demonstrate consistent academic excellence, a positive attitude toward learning, actively participate in extra curricular activities, and contribute significantly to the life of the School.
To apply, families and prospective students are invited to write a letter detailing how your family and child exemplifies each of our School values – Belonging, Creativity, Humility, Integrity, Compassion and Excellence.

Tarrkarri Scholarship
The Tarrkarri Scholarship recognises the importance of culture, connection and opportunity for First Nations students at St Andrew’s. This values-based scholarship reflects our commitment to supporting First Nations students and their families as valued members of our school community.
Applications are open to prospective students entering Reception to Year 6 in 2027.
